“Nitakua depressed” Smart Joker on why he doesn’t like flaunting his wealth online unlike fellow celebrities

Published on

Kenyan comedian Smart Joker has shared the reason why he doesn’t flaunt his lifestyle online despite being a popular comedian.

He recently opened up about his decision not to flaunt his wealth online, revealing that his fear of slipping into depression plays a significant role in his choice. “Sitaki Kua Depressed’

In an age where social media is often flooded with displays of luxury and success, Smart Joker has taken a different approach. He explained that while many celebrities and influencers regularly showcase their affluent lifestyles, the pressure to constantly present a picture-perfect life can lead to a dangerous mental space.

He explained further, stating that flaunting what you have online means that the day you will lack you will definitely be on your own as you are less likely to receive help from the public because you already painted a shiny picture and set class already.

“Siku utakwama? Siku utakuja online kuomba msaada kwa wananchi, si watakuambia boss si tunakuonanga na BMW? Ile gari unapostingi ni ya?”

Smart Joker likes keeping his life off cameras and private because that is where his peace lies, and he doesn’t want to put himself in a position where he is clearly showing he is of a different class than others.

How Smart Joker deals with Public Pressure

The father of three also shared how he manages to deal with public pressure since he normally boards a matatu on a daily basis, saying he actually doesn’t mind and has started prioritising things because he saw no value in prioritising something that was a liability in his life.

He is living his life and accepting the way he is, adding that he has enough to cater for his needs, and that is what matters fo him.
